| 18:20:15 | mriedem | is this for busted migrations? | |
| 18:20:53 | larsks | mriedem: well, maybe. We hit a situation on Friday at boston university where we were unable to schedule new instances on an empty compute node. It turns out there were a number of stale allocations there (and elsewhere in the cluster). | |
| 18:20:59 | larsks | Maybe they were caused by busted migrations? | |
| 18:21:15 | larsks | But this fixed the immediate problem regardless of the cause. | |
| 18:21:16 | mriedem | what version of nova? | |
| 18:21:33 | larsks | It is now pike, but it was upgraded from ocata. And possibly from earlier. | |
| 18:21:42 | mriedem | pike GA or latest stable release? | |
| 18:21:53 | mriedem | post pike GA we found a number of bugs in places where we didn't cleanup allocations properly | |
| 18:21:55 | mriedem | those should all be fixed now | |
| 18:21:57 | larsks | Uh...whatever red hat is distributing in rhel-osp 12. | |
| 18:22:03 | mriedem | heh, fair enough | |
| 18:23:37 | mriedem | https://github.com/larsks/os-placement-tools/blob/master/check_placement.py#L16 is nice | |
| 18:24:11 | larsks | Thanks! | |
| 18:24:14 | dansmith | mriedem: nope | |
| 18:24:41 | dansmith | mriedem: it does coincide with me ruminating about deleting duplicate allocations in -placement last week though | |
| 18:25:27 | mriedem | wonder if anyone ever started on that osc-placement change to orchestrate setting inventory on an entire placement provider aggregate set | |
| 18:25:39 | dansmith | larsks: that looks awesome | |
| 18:25:39 | mriedem | unrelated to this besides placement tooling | |
| 18:25:59 | dansmith | larsks: you should check for instance state and only agree to --fix those in ACTIVE though | |
| 18:26:13 | dansmith | larsks: before ocata (ish?) you could have legit reasons for two allocations for one instance, because that's how we did migrations | |
| 18:26:28 | dansmith | but if the instance is ACTIVE and has two, that'll always need fixing I think | |
| 18:26:35 | dansmith | mriedem: right? | |
| 18:26:43 | mriedem | and/or don't touch any instances with a non-null task_state | |
| 18:26:57 | mriedem | before pike the computes would heal allocations | |
| 18:27:06 | dansmith | yeah | |
| 18:27:23 | mriedem | but yeah don't fix an instance that's undergoing a task_state transition | |
| 18:27:36 | mriedem | yee be warned | |
| 18:31:38 | larsks | So noted. | |
